Herpes zoster Sykdommer i blod og lymfatiske organer Leukopeni, trombocytopeni Forstyrrelser i immunsystemet WebOct 17, 2012 · Tryptophan deficiency increases anxiety and irritability in humans and may modulate aggressiveness and the response to stress in animals . Opposed to these findings, based on acute depletion techniques, chronic, moderate tryptophan deficiency showed little effect on behavior of weaned pigs . L-Tryptophan is an amino acid, which, if lacking in the diet, can cause anxiety. Serotonin is made from L-Tryptophan and serotonin is the neurotransmitter in the horse’s brain that helps your horse feel calm.
